If your looking for something better you could try this out


I really haven’t seen anyone else use these when people post pics of their mixing space, but they work out great for me. I duct taped the fronts of the drawers to block out light and labeled each drawer with the corresponding name of the flavor to be stored inside and taped black poster board on the back to keep light out as well.

Pros:

–Easy identification

Since every flavoring has its own drawer and is clearly labeled it’s easy to find what your looking for. I have a different shelf for every vendor and within that shelf I have flavors grouped together e.g. fruits, creams, bakery, etc.

–Ease of access

Since every flavor has its own drawer there is no need to rummage around for flavors… It saves sooo much time opening one drawer vs. moving five bottles to get to the one that you want.

–Expandable

As your flavor collection grows you can buy more of these and stack them one on top of the other as they have small notches molded into the tops of them and small legs at the bottom.

Cons

They do take up a lot of space multi-purpose space that’s in public view and you have a lot of flavors. The good news is that if you have a dedicated mixing space or don’t care about what your mixing area in a public space looks like the space that these take up is visual space as the depth of the shelves is only a few inches.
